Handover Note — Hedging Position, Kestrel Imports

To my successor: we locked forward contracts covering 60% of projected marlin-denominated exposure through Q2, per the finance committee's October decision. Rationale, counterparty terms, and rollover triggers are documented in the treasury file. Please review the quarterly variance thresholds carefully before adjusting anything. The strategic reasoning sits in the note below.

management briefing: Project Ulavan slips by two quarters because of the staffing delay.

## v3.8.2

Health checks for plugin endpoints now run behind the Graywick load balancer. Plugins must respond to GET /healthz within 2s or be rotated out. Old /ping route is deprecated; removal in v4.0. Backoff on failed checks is now exponential, capped at 60s. Update your manifests to declare the health path explicitly — implicit defaults are gone. Questions about the rollout should go to the engineer who owns it.

named custodian: Brivan Eliath Quenox Frador

**14:22 — Bulk edit anomaly detected.** An operator at Quellmark used the Ledgerly admin table's bulk-edit action to update 4,312 account rows, but the audit middleware only recorded the first 500. The remaining edits applied silently, bypassing the change-log hook due to a pagination cutoff in the batch writer. No privilege escalation occurred, but attribution gaps persist for 41 minutes of activity. We reconstructed the missing entries from replica diffs. The exact build under review is recorded below.

session token of bawep-yadup = htk21_528abd376e3c5a4ec24a1